How Do I Connect My Roku TV to Google?

When trying to connect your Roku TV to Google Home, you might encounter a number of different problems. You may receive errors, such as “unknown application” or “corrupted data.” Alternatively, you may find that you have a poor internet connection. If this is the case, you can try restarting your Roku TV to fix the problem.

First, you need to make sure that you have the latest version of Roku OS 8.1. Also, you need to make sure that your Roku device is connected to the same Wi-Fi network as Google Home. Next, you need to sign into your Roku account with a Google account. Then, go to Google Home and select “Set up device”.

How Do I Connect My Roku Remote to Google Home?

If you have a Google Home or Google Assistant smart speaker, you can easily connect your Roku TV to it. To do this, you should download the Quick Remote application, which will link your Google Home to your Roku streaming device. This app will allow you to control your Roku TV with voice commands. Once you have downloaded the app, you should sign in with your Google account.

You can use your mobile device to open the Google Play/App Store, and then search for “Google Home.” In this app, you must be connected to the same Wi-Fi network and have a stable internet connection. Once you’ve opened the app, click “Add” at the top of the screen and then select “Roku.” The Roku TV will appear in the list of devices that can be linked to your Google Home.

If the app is still unable to connect to your Roku TV, you might need to update the Roku TV’s firmware. This will fix the connectivity issues and fix any bugs that are preventing the device from connecting to Google Home. If this method fails, you may need to perform a factory reset of the device.
